Men's Golf Places Second at Dickinson Spring Invitational

3/23/2025 9:26:00 PM

CARLISLE, Pa. – The Franklin & Marshall men's golf team concluded the Dickinson Spring Invitational notching two top-three finishes in the team standings on Sunday at the Carlisle Barracks. Both the Diplomats' "A" team and "B" team ended the tournament even-par to tie for second in the field of 16 teams. Dickinson claimed a first-place finish in the tournament as the Red Devils shot 11-under par for the weekend.

Alex Gore shot four-under par on the day to finish in second in the field of 85 competitors. Oliver Clark followed by carding two-under par to place third in the tournament. Max Silverman and Wayne He finished the weekend shooting one-under par to tie for fourth. Roy Anderson tallied an even-par finish to end the two-day event in seventh.

Shane Lawler ended the weekend two-over par to place in eighth, while Jack Cooley and Chris Dorey both carded a three-over par finish to end the tournament tied for 12th. Pablo Rodriguez tallied an eight-over par for the weekend to place in a tie for 25th. Winston Thai scored 11-over par to place 30th in the field.

Franklin & Marshall now prepares for the McDaniel Spring Invitational at Bridges Golf Club, starting on Saturday at 8:00 a.m.
